For us, the first weekend in December is when we put up our Christmas tree and other decorations, and what better way to celebrate the kick-off to Christmas than with a glass of fizz? 

We’ve chosen Wyfold Vineyard Brut 2017 from Barbara Laithwaite’s two-hectare Oxfordshire estate. 

And if you think English Sparkling Wine can’t be every bit as luxurious as Champagne, think again. This wine uses the same classic grapes that you’d find in Champagne, and follows the same traditional-method style of making fizz.  

In fact, many of the greatest Champagne houses have been busy snapping up land in the UK, particularly in the south, where the climate creates the perfect growing conditions for the very best bubbly.
